Thumbs up Nice Canon SD850IS Review

Nice review of the PowerShot SD850IS! A bit late for me, but useful nonetheless.

I picked up the Japanese version of this camera (IXY 810IS) and like it very, very much. It's simple enough for my wife as well, and easy to use in the UW housing (though I'm not so happy with my UW photos).

I've been too lazy to read through the english version of the PDF manual completely, but your review pointed out features I didn't even know about - like time-lapse and post hoc red eye removal.

I also didn't know about the accessory flash - though I'm unsure I would need it. I notice when I go on Macro Mode, the flash is often partially blocked by the lens barrel. Howver, maybe I should not be taking macro photos with a flash.

The other only real problem I have with this camera is the super fast (class 6) SD card I bought for it won't mount on my Mac - can't even format it. So, I have to use the camera to transfer photos. Not so great when the battery is low.

In any case, thanks again for your hard work. I'll refer to your review often so I can understand my camera better.
